Straight flush orders that have not been closed today will not be automatically cancelled after the market closes today, and will be entrusted tomorrow?
Hello, today's order for open stocks will be revoked when the securities company liquidates. Therefore, the orders for stocks that have not been closed today will not be continued tomorrow.
If investors want to continue trading tomorrow, they can choose to entrust a securities company after liquidation, and this entrustment will enter call auction tomorrow. Once the commission is completed, there will be a handling fee.
